About The Position

The Cisco Component Quality and Technology team provides outstanding customer value through technical innovation and quality solutions. We are seeking a driven and experienced technical expert in semiconductor components and their applications in high-speed systems. Devices we work with include ASICs, NPUs, CPUs, Ethernet switches, FPGAs, PHYs, retimers, etc. You will work directly with Cisco design, manufacturing, operations and quality engineering teams, as well as component vendors.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ct semiconductor component selection, testing, and qualification to meet product specifications.
  • Lead investigations and end-to-end failure analysis for component and system issues, working with vendors to define, implement, and verify corrective and preventive actions (8D, RCCA, etc.)
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ams on component selection, risk assessment, design reviews, and proactively drive risk mitigation.
  • Analyze and influence vendor technology roadmaps in support of Cisco product development requirements.
